Demand for databases will continue to rebound in 2005, as enterprises expand their application portfolios and outgrow existing ones. Increased competition will drive prices down, but overall, database license revenues will continue to grow at a slow pace. Database security will continue to gain importance across the industry, especially for those storing private data, primarily driven by increased intrusions and growing regulatory requirements. Open source will strengthen its bid for a slice of the low-end database market with enhanced features and technical support. Database innovation and product enhancements will continue to be focused around security, automation, synchronization, performance, and availability.
